Detailed insights for B12 0XE

Overview

Postcode B12 0XE is located in a major urban area, within the Bordesley & Highgate ward of Birmingham in the West Midlands region, and forms part of the Sparkbrook North area. It has very high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 187.9 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. The average income per household in Sparkbrook North is £34,950 per year. The nearest station is Bordesley located about 0.5 miles away. There are 8 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area. There are 2 parks nearby, closest medium park is Highgate Park.

Property prices in Bordesley & Highgate

Based on 78 recent sales, the median property price is £194,500 in Bordesley & Highgate area, with individual transactions ranging from £35,000 up to £457,000.
